as I mentioned before - there were no British subjects in the rig, the BP supervisory staff or Halliburton. I doubt if there are more than a hand full, at the most, of britishers in the BP head office in Houston.
it was completely an American show - in fact the name british petroleum has not been used in the USA for some years. their consultants and experts decided "beyond petroleum" had a better ring to it for the US market.
they also changed their logo from the imperious BP shield to a stupid green kind of daisy thing! I don't know if they did that only here or it was world wide.
rig people I know always said they hated to be contracted to BP; safety was pushed forward all the time by BP - until they were delayed and the drilling schedule [and therefore the cost] was affected - then safety and everything else went overboard in a rush to play catch-up!
apparently other producers big and small [and apart from the big 5 there was elf, agip, and canadian companies that I recall] did not fuck the drilling contractors about like BP did.
